Definition of gas

(noun) the state of matter distinguished from the solid and liquid states by: relatively low density and viscosity; relatively great expansion and contraction with changes in pressure and temperature; the ability to diffuse readily; and the spontaneous tendency to become distributed uniformly throughout any container
a volatile flammable mixture of hydrocarbons (hexane and heptane and octane etc.) derived from petroleum; used mainly as a fuel in internal-combustion engines
a state of excessive gas in the alimentary canal
a pedal that controls the throttle valve; "he stepped on the gas"
a fossil fuel in the gaseous state; used for cooking and heating homes
(verb) attack with gas; subject to gas fumes; "The despot gassed the rebellious tribes"
show off
